A couple of places half an hour's drive either side of Nerja are paraje natural Desembocadura Río Vélez, west of Torre Del Mar and Suarez's Pools, Motril. Check the website Charca Suárez Wetlands, Costa tropical.net, I believe that it is only open late afternoon.
